Output 95013194cc2dc2290695b327d2c4845184aa9ac105b132a43cd5354427808f31:32
- value
- 503459
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8012e37b5ef62aed259a21d21cf0c2f6ed5404a6 OP_EQUAL
- address
- 3DND3W1rNiShSVYFiYitMpMCLZkpx57MdU
- transaction
- 95013194cc2dc2290695b327d2c4845184aa9ac105b132a43cd5354427808f31
- confirmations
- 138623
- spent
- true